Concert Raises $500,000 to Help Gulf Coast Evacuees through Habitat for Humanity AUBURN HILLS, Mich., Dec. 13 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Despite the bitter cold and snow, three of country music's top performers soldiered on in Michigan determined to bring plenty of warmth and excitement to fans with great music for a great cause. Martina McBride, LeAnn Rimes and Carrie Underwood joined forces to light up the stage at Chrysler Financial's Country Cares holiday concert. The performances took place at The Palace of Auburn Hills in front of 10,000 fans and raised $500,000 in ticket sales for Habitat for Humanity. All net proceeds from Detroit area concert goers went to benefit Habitat for Humanity as they help those specifically affected in the Gulf Coast communities damaged by recent hurricanes. Money raised by last week's concert will fund multiple homes for evacuees including those who have settled in Southeast Michigan. A highlight of the evening was a special presentation to one of Habitat for Humanity's partner families. A partner family is Habitat's term for the family that will help build their own home, and then purchase it at cost, with a zero percent interest rate loan, to make it affordable. Celestine Torres and her family are rebuilding their lives after Katrina destroyed their New Orleans home. After receiving the keys, Torres and her family were presented with the front porch railing for their new home autographed by each of the artists.
